Important Materials for Saddle Dump Pouches
The material of your saddle dump pouch affects how well it works and how long it lasts.
- Nylon: This is a very common material. It’s strong and lightweight. It also resists water well.
- Polyester: Similar to nylon, polyester is durable and can handle wear and tear.
- Canvas: This is a thicker, tougher fabric. It’s very strong but can be heavier. It might not be as waterproof as nylon.
- Leather: Some high-end pouches use leather. Leather looks nice and is very durable, but it needs more care to stay in good shape and can be expensive.
What Makes a Pouch Great (or Not So Great)? Quality Factors
Several things can make a saddle dump pouch better or worse.
Factors That Improve Quality:
- Strong Stitching: Well-sewn seams mean the pouch won’t fall apart easily.
- Good Quality Zippers or Closures: Smooth-working zippers and secure buckles last longer.
- Reinforced Stress Points: Areas that get pulled a lot, like strap attachments, should be extra strong.
- Water-Resistant Coatings: These help keep your belongings dry in wet weather.
Factors That Reduce Quality:
- Flimsy Material: Thin fabric tears easily.
- Poor Stitching: Loose threads or weak seams are a sign of low quality.
- Cheap Zippers: Zippers that get stuck or break make the pouch hard to use.
- Weak Straps: Straps that stretch or come undone are a safety concern.
